What is the e signature legitimateness for independent contractor agreement in united states

The e signature legitimateness for independent contractor agreements in the United States refers to the legal recognition of electronic signatures in binding contracts between independent contractors and businesses. Under the Electronic Signatures in Global and National Commerce Act (ESIGN) and the Uniform Electronic Transactions Act (UETA), electronic signatures hold the same legal weight as traditional handwritten signatures, provided they meet certain criteria. This means that independent contractors can confidently sign agreements electronically, ensuring that their contracts are enforceable and compliant with federal and state laws.

Key elements of the e signature legitimateness for independent contractor agreement in united states

Several key elements contribute to the e signature legitimateness of independent contractor agreements in the United States. These include:

  • Intent to sign: Both parties must demonstrate a clear intention to sign the agreement electronically.
  • Consent to use electronic signatures: All parties involved must agree to use electronic signatures instead of traditional handwritten ones.
  • Association with the record: The electronic signature must be linked to the document in a way that ensures its integrity and authenticity.
  • Retention of records: Parties should maintain a copy of the signed agreement in a format that accurately reflects the original document.

Security & Compliance Guidelines

When using e signatures for independent contractor agreements, adhering to security and compliance guidelines is crucial. Ensure that the eSignature platform, like airSlate SignNow, employs encryption to protect sensitive information. Additionally, verify that the platform complies with relevant regulations, such as ESIGN and UETA. It is also advisable to implement authentication measures, such as two-factor authentication, to verify the identity of the signers, thus enhancing the security of the signing process.

Digital vs. Paper-Based Signing

Digital signing offers several advantages over traditional paper-based signing for independent contractor agreements. Electronic signatures streamline the signing process, allowing for quicker turnaround times and reducing the need for physical document handling. Digital records are easier to store, search, and retrieve, minimizing the risk of loss or damage. Moreover, e signatures enhance accessibility, enabling contractors to sign documents from anywhere, at any time, using various devices.
